Array ( [author_name] => rony [error] => [m] => [p] => 0 [post_parent] => [subpost] => [subpost_id] => [attachment] => [attachment_id] => 0 [name] => [static] => [pagename] => [page_id] => 0 [second] => [minute] => [hour] => [day] => 0 [monthnum] => 0 [year] => 0 [w] => 0 [category_name] => [tag] => [cat] => [tag_id] => [author] => 2 [feed] => [tb] => [paged] => 1 [meta_key] => [meta_value] => [preview] => [s] => [sentence] => [title] => [fields] => [menu_order] => [embed] => [category__in] => Array ( ) [category__not_in] => Array ( ) [category__and] => Array ( ) [post__in] => Array ( ) [post__not_in] => Array ( ) [post_name__in] => Array ( ) [tag__in] => Array ( ) [tag__not_in] => Array ( ) [tag__and] => Array ( ) [tag_slug__in] => Array ( ) [tag_slug__and] => Array ( ) [post_parent__in] => Array ( ) [post_parent__not_in] => Array ( ) [author__in] => Array ( ) [author__not_in] => Array ( ) [ignore_sticky_posts] => [suppress_filters] => [cache_results] => 1 [update_post_term_cache] => 1 [lazy_load_term_meta] => 1 [update_post_meta_cache] => 1 [post_type] => [posts_per_page] => 10 [nopaging] => [comments_per_page] => 50 [no_found_rows] => [order] => DESC [orderby] => date )
Software Development

Learn How to Automatically Release Software

In the DevOps building blocks tutorial, we identified automation as a useful technique for quickly delivering software and developing collaboration between development and operations. We also discussed other benefits of automated releasing such as risk minimization and reproducibility. In this article, we will focus on what is needed before automation can happen and implementation of

Web Programming Tutorials

Learn About Sass Variables for Customizing in Bootstrap 4

In this article, we are going to discuss the use of Sass variables for customizing our web front end HTML pages in Bootstrap 4. SASS stands for Syntactically Awesome Stylesheet. It is a CSS pre-processor which helps in the reduction of the repetition with CSS that ultimately saves our time. It is known to be

Software Development

Learn the sources of conceptual dysfunction in a DevOps project

Generally. we can think of a concept as a blueprint that helps realize business significance. A concept contains the details of the people involved and their contribution towards the stated objective of realizing business value. A simple criterion of knowing that a concept is clear is checking if it can be understood without any difficulties

Web Programming Tutorials

Learn about Event Emitters in Node.js

In the last article, we discussed the concept of event driven programming where the Node.js application runs on a single thread but still it achieves concurrency through event and callback functions. Callback is defined as an event which is invoked or called immediately after the completion of a particular task. In this article, we are

Software Development

Learn how the areas of DevOps matrix are useful in a project

The objective of DevOps is to eliminate the barriers that exist between development and operations. In the attempt to eliminate barriers, overlapping mechanisms need to be put in place. First cooperation among operations and development is required in putting the project to deployment. Second, operations and development need to cooperate in providing feedback gained from

Java Programming

Learn how to implement AOP in the Spring framework

The Aspect Oriented Programming (AOP) offers a new way of looking at how software programming can be done. When compared to the Object Oriented Programming (OOP), the AOP does not represent a total or drastic departure to how programming is done. AOP just represents a new philosophy of programming and aims at improving efficiency between

Web Programming Tutorials

Learn Event Driven Programming in Node.js

In this article, we are going to discuss the concept of event driven programming in Node JS. It may be surprising to learn that the Node.js is an application that runs on a single thread but we can still achieve concurrency in Node.js with the help of event and callback functions. Callback can be defined

Web Programming Tutorials

Learn about Typography in Bootstrap 4

In this article, we are going to learn about the Typography feature of Bootstrap 4. Typography refers to the various styles present in Bootstrap 4 style sheets which define how various text elements will appear on the web page. It shows how certain text elements are rendered when we use Bootstrap without including the style

Web Programming Tutorials

Learn to Build an Audio Player Using HTML5

In this article, we are going to build an audio player using HTML5. We are going to incorporate HTML5 audio features as well as JavaScript and jQuery. We will add features like Play, Previous, Next, Pause, Stop and Volume control. We will also include a progress-bar with time, as well as create a playlist of

Software Development

Learn how Shared Incentives are Used in DevOps

When using a DevOps approach in a software project, we think of development and operations as one team. Therefore, we need to have a clear definition of a team. A team can be considered as a group where its different members work together depending on each other in order to achieve an objective that is